Analysis of Gene Expression Omnibus high-throughput sequencing data for the determination of microribonucleic acids in the blood plasma of patients with glioblastomas
Purpose of the study. This work is devoted to the study of blood plasma miRNA patterns in blood plasma using high-throughput sequencing of the Omnibus Gene Expression base and the search for candidate miRNA molecules for the development of a minimally invasive diagnostic panel.Materials and methods....
